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
- All adults (age >18 years of age) patients diagnosed with gallstone disease following confirmatory imaging at an East Kent University Foundation Trust Hospital. Patients of any gender, ethnicity or socio-economic background are eligible as well as pregnant women. Patients undergoing both open and laparoscopic cholecystectomy will be included.
Exclusion Criteria:
- Patients less than 18 years of age and patients who do not have capacity to consent to involvement in the study.
